According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 6 reports of Bronchial wall thickening have been filed in association with SPIRONOLACTONE (spironolactone). This represents 0.0% of all adverse event reports for SPIRONOLACTONE.

Is Bronchial wall thickening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for SPIRONOLACTONE. However, 6 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
